in reply to Creating large apps
My advice borne of experience is that the bigger the project, the more "proper" techniques you need to use and the harder you need to push back on management who will pressure you for a quicker development cycle at the expense of proper development methodology.
So just do what you always knew you were supposed to do on the smaller projects, but never had time or management buy-in to do.
In terms of getting management buy-in, I would recommend doing your best to convince them that as a project grows in size, its complexity grows exponentially; thus, company will save money in the long run on any big project by investing in proper design and development practices up front and dramatically reducing maintenance and development costs in the long run. If they're unwilling to do that, I would question whether the project should be pursued in the first place. After all, if they balk at taking the time to do things right, they are implicitly telling you that they don't expect the project to be around very long.
|
|---|